What does pumpkin do for face?
Pumpkin is a good source of vitamin C which is a powerful antioxidant and also contains beta-carotene which helps to reverse UV damage and improve skin texture. It helps to promote the production of collagen, thus improving your skin tone and elasticity.
How do you make a pumpkin face mask?
Making a Basic Pumpkin Mask Make a basic pumpkin facial mask if you have normal, dry, or oily skin. Put 1 tablespoon of organic, canned pumpkin into a small cup or bowl. Add 1 teaspoon of honey. Consider adding some extras. Mix everything together with a fork. Apply the mask to a clean face. Wait 15 minutes. Wash the mask off with lukewarm water.
What are the benefits of Pumpkin facial?
Pumpkin Face Mask Benefits for Skin. Pumpkin contains vitamin A , C, and E, and antioxidants, which help fight sun damage and wrinkles. It also has fruit enzymes that help naturally exfoliate dead skin cells.

What is Pumpkin facial?
The pumpkin facial are ideal for most skin types except people who have Rosacea , Psoriasis or Eczema on the face. It will balance out the driest of skin AND the acne prone skin. The exfoliating properties of pumpkin will slough away dead skin cells which then serums and moisturizers are more readily absorbed.
